IrLugX640E™ | VGA Thermal Engine Core

Spectral range - Material

8 - 14 µm - VOx uncooled microbolometer

Frame rate full frame

9 - 60 Hz

Resolution - Pixel Pitch

640 x 480 px - 12 µm

Dimensions - Weight

30 x 30 x 23 mm3 (no lens, no shutter, native) - < 38 g

Interfaces (Video format)

Native DF40C-60DP (YCbCr, Mono16), CameraLink (16-bit), HD/3G SDI (1080p), MIPI (May 2023), UVC (June 2023)

Image Processing / Calibration

On module

VGA Thermal Engine Core with on-board image processing

The IrLugX640E SXGA thermal engine core boasts a resolution of 640 x 380 pixels with a 12 µm pitch. The high-definition sensor consists of an uncooled microbolometer array developed by Lynred. With its extreme low size of 30x 30 x 23 mm3, weight <38 g and power consumption under < 3W, the IrLugX640E is designed for easy integration into sub-systems. With the addition of a processing board compared to the camera module, all image optimization is done on-board (BPR, UC, Image enhancement, AGC).

The IrLugX1M3E is available with the native interface DF40C-60DP (YCbCr, Mono16) or CameraLink (16-bit), HD/3G SDI (1080p), MIPI (May 2023) or UVC (June 2023).

The IrLugX640E comes with a shutterless function and a ‘time to image’ under 6 seconds from power up. For applications requiring it, an optional mechanical shutter is available. The VGA (1280 x 1024 pixels) format of this HD thermal camera module offers unmatched image quality with an NETD as low as 30 mK.

The IrLugX640E is a dual-use (non-ITAR) thermal camera module with a frame rate up to 60 Hz.

Applications include:

  • Use in UAVs (Unmanned aerial Vehicles)
  • Use in UGVs (Unmanned Ground Vehicles)
  • Surveillance, security and maritime cameras
  • night-vision goggles
  • automotive and aircraft safety vision
  • machine vision inspection
  • medical images
  • and much more
